Description
Episode Description
Robert Walquist was a senior executive at TRW Corporation who was closely involved with research on the Strategic Defense Initiative (SDI). He recalls that defense contractors generally reacted with surprise at President Reagan's speech announcing SDI. He goes on to explain some of the inner workings of defense contracting, how a company gets involved in a new government program, how it works with government laboratories and other institutions, and how it handles changing budget levels. He notes that SDI in some aspects has built on research - on lasers, for example - that has long been underway. He describes the current state of play on the laser test program with which TRW is involved, and what the next steps will be if the government chooses it over a rival program. He believes a space-based defense system will never be perfect but would provide protection for the population it serves.
